Gosalpur Population - Jabalpur, Madhya Pradesh

Gosalpur is a large village located in Sihora Tehsil of Jabalpur district, Madhya Pradesh with total 1433 families residing. The Gosalpur village has population of 6251 of which 3207 are males while 3044 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Gosalp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 806 which makes up 12.89 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Gosalpur village is 949 which is higher than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Gosalpur as per census is 938, higher than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Gosalp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Gosalpur village was 80.37 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Gosalpur Male literacy stands at 87.28 % while female literacy rate was 73.10 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 23.55 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 4.43 % of total population in Gosalpur village.

Work Profile

In Gosalpur village out of total population, 2584 were engaged in work activities. 92.57 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 7.43 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 2584 workers engaged in Main Work, 163 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 382 were Agricultural labourer.
